In the rapidly evolving landscape of last-mile delivery, electric bikes for delivery businesses in India are emerging as game-changers, promising efficiency, sustainability, and cost-effectiveness.

The logistics industry is undergoing a profound shift, driven by the need for cost-effective and efficient solutions. Woltz Energy’s innovative approach addresses this demand head-on, offering electric two-wheelers that are purpose-built to navigate the challenges faced by delivery businesses like grocery, food, e-commerce, post and parcel and hyperlocal operating on a small and medium scale.

The Rise of Electric Two Wheelers:

Electric vehicles (EVs) have been hailed as a cornerstone of the sustainable transportation movement, and electric two-wheelers have taken center stage for urban deliveries. The compact nature of two-wheelers combined with their ability to reach more customer, avoid rising petrol costs and run on minimal downtime aligns perfectly with the requirements of short-distance deliveries, making them an ideal choice for businesses focusing on last-mile logistics.

Meeting Diverse Industry Needs:

For grocery and food deliveries, these electric two-wheelers provide the necessary storage compartments to ensure fresh produce and food reaches customers intact and on-time. In the hyperlocal delivery segment, where time is the most important asset for a delivery business these vehicles navigate through traffic effortlessly allowing the business to deliver to more customers in less time.

Advantages Beyond Efficiency:

Electric two-wheelers not only optimize delivery processes but also offer substantial long-term benefits. Lower operational costs, reduced maintenance requirements, and access to government incentives are just some of the advantages that make these vehicles economically viable for small and medium-sized businesses.

Challenges and Solutions:

While the transition to electric two-wheelers presents numerous benefits, there are challenges to overcome, such as charging infrastructure, range limitations and high costs.
